【】初学者。关于JavaScript的数组的有关问题
【在线等】菜鸟求助。。。关于JavaScript的数组的问题。
var company=[{"id":1,"point":"116.404234,39.913951","name":"海大科技","desc":"企业
描述信息!"},{"id":2,"point":"116.418463,39.921809","name":"新记传媒","desc":"企业
描述信息!"},{"id":3,"point":"116.406534,39.921367","name":"东方不败","desc":"企业
描述信息!"}];
这个数组有点看不懂。。。。
(function(){
var infoWindow = new BMap.InfoWindow(getInfoContent(company
[i].name,company[i].desc,company[i].mylogo),{width:400});
、、还有就是这里,它调用数据的时候为什么可以这样写company[i].name.....其实问题还是在这个数组。
------解决方案--------------------
数组中可以存任何类型的值,如果[1,2,3],你可以很清楚的知道 是个存放数字的数组
上面的数组,存了对象
company[i] 指向数组中的某个对象 等价于
{"id":2,"point":"116.418463,39.921809","name":"新记传媒","desc":"企业描述信息!"}.name
------解决方案--------------------
修改为
var company=[{"id":1,"point":"116.404234,39.913951","name":"海大科技","desc":"企业
描述信息!"},{"id":2,"point":"116.418463,39.921809","name":"新记传媒","desc":"企业
描述信息!"},{"id":3,"point":"116.406534,39.921367","name":"东方不败","desc":"企业
描述信息!"}];
这个数组有点看不懂。。。。
(function(){
var infoWindow = new BMap.InfoWindow(getInfoContent(company
[i].name,company[i].desc,company[i].mylogo),{width:400});
、、还有就是这里,它调用数据的时候为什么可以这样写company[i].name.....其实问题还是在这个数组。
------解决方案--------------------
数组中可以存任何类型的值,如果[1,2,3],你可以很清楚的知道 是个存放数字的数组
上面的数组,存了对象
company[i] 指向数组中的某个对象 等价于
{"id":2,"point":"116.418463,39.921809","name":"新记传媒","desc":"企业描述信息!"}.name
------解决方案--------------------
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
修改为
<meta http-equiv="Content-Type" content="text/html; charset=gbk" />